In The Shattered Dreams of Jane, Samuel Ludke delivers a haunting collection of poems that wander through the fragile corridors of love, loss, and self-destruction. Each piece feels like a fragment of a broken mirror - reflecting moments of tenderness, regret, and the impossible beauty of pain. Through Jane's eyes - or perhaps the ghost of her memory - Ludke paints a portrait of a soul unraveling under the weight of her own heart. The poems move between dream and reality, between the living and the lost, revealing the quiet violence of hope and the mercy of remembrance.
